Retail turnover 1 percent up

Retail turnover was 1 percent up in December 2011 from December 2010. Prices of retail commodities were 2.5 percent higher. As a result, retail volume shrank by 1.5 percent.

Manufacturing turnover substantially higher

Dutch manufacturers realised a 19 percent turnover increase in January 2011 compared to the same month in 2010. This is the highest increase in manufacturing turnover ever measured.

Unemployment below pre-crisis level

In November, the unemployment rate dropped to 3.5 percent of the Dutch labour force. This was slightly below the level just before the onset of the crisis at the end of 2008.
